195/60 R14 stands taller than 165/55 R16 — bigger rolling diameter, slightly more clearance, calmer cruise revs.

Minus-sizing from 165/55 R16 to 195/60 R14 pairs a smaller 14-inch wheel with more rubber between the rim and road. This wheel and tire pairing preserves rolling diameter within a hair of the original. There's no meaningful speedometer deviation — the dashboard speed stays honest. More sidewall typically improves comfort and curb protection, especially on city streets. Diameter change stays inside the conservative ±3% safety window — an OEM-safe fitment on most vehicles.

Direct answer

Is 195/60 R14 OEM-safe?

Yes. Overall diameter changes by +0.29% versus 165/55 R16. OEM-safe. Speedometer, ABS, ESP and gearing remain inside the factory tolerance.

Direct answer

Will 195/60 R14 rub?

Possibly. Width changes by +30 mm and diameter by +1.7 mm. Possible rub at full lock or full suspension compression — verify fender lip and inner strut clearance before committing.

Direct answer

Does the speedometer change?

Yes — by +0.29%. Swapping 165/55 R16 for 195/60 R14 changes overall diameter, so at an indicated 100 km/h your true speed becomes 100.3 km/h. That's within the ±3% OEM tolerance — no recalibration needed.

Direct answer

Does lower sidewall affect comfort?

Yes — softer ride. Sidewall changes by +26.3 mm (55% → 60%). Ride softens and absorbs bumps better, with slightly less precise turn-in.

Real-world consequences

Pros / cons

Wider tire (+30 mm)

Section width
  • More dry grip and cornering bite
  • Sharper steering response on initial turn-in
  • Bigger contact patch under braking
  • More road noise on coarse asphalt
  • Worse aquaplaning resistance in standing water
  • Higher rolling resistance, small MPG hit
  • Possible fender or strut contact at full lock

Taller sidewall (+5% aspect)

Sidewall
  • Plusher ride, better pothole and curb protection
  • More forgiving on bad roads and trails
  • Lower wheel-damage risk on impacts
  • More sidewall flex, softer steering feel
  • Slightly delayed turn-in response

-2″ rim downsize

Wheel diameter
  • Cheaper winter / track tire sizing
  • Lighter overall package, less unsprung mass
  • More sidewall = more impact absorption
  • Less aggressive stance
  • Possible brake caliper clearance issue going too small

Speedometer impact

At a true 100 km/h, your dashboard will read 100.3 km/h after switching to 195/60 R14 — a +0.29% offset. Use the speedometer error calculator for any indicated speed, and the speedometer error guide for the full background.

Ground clearance change

The new tire's half-diameter changes ride height by +0.8 mm. Small differences are absorbed by suspension travel, but anything beyond ±10 mm can affect headlight aim, fender clearance and bump-stop margin. See the plus-sizing guide before committing.
